For most healthy adults, including seniors, a normal resting heart rate is between 60 and 80 beats per minute. In general, women have slightly higher heart rates than men. Professional athletes may have healthy resting heart rates as low as 35, a number that would cause serious concern for the average adult. disfigure thesaurus https://sptcpa.com

WebSex — heart rate is generally higher in females than males. Physical activity — if you've been moving around a lot, your heart rate will increase. Fitness level — your resting heart rate may be lower if you're very fit.
